What to Look For in a Twin Pushchair
If you have two kids or babies of the same age, a twin pushchair could be a great choice. They have two seats for your children and are typically equipped with comfortable carrycots for infants as well as compatibility with car seats for older toddlers.
Find models with easy-to-use push handles and an GIANT storage basket. Accessories like cups holders and a tray for snacks for kids and parents are also helpful.

Some twin buggies begin life as single pushchairs but can be extended to fit two seats or carrycots by adding an adapter. This is a cost-effective solution for families with more than one child and it means you won't need to buy an entirely new buggy once your older child has outgrown it. It might not be the best choice for twins in their early months, as they'll need to be the same weight and age.

Convertible
A convertible twin pushchair is a flexible option that lets you change the configuration as your children develop. It starts out as one pram but has adaptors that attach to the frame to allow for a second seat, carrycot or car seat. These models tend to be bigger than regular buggy, but they can fit through doorways and are more maneuverable through kerbs and up and down. They also allow you to use a toddler seat as well as an infant car seat or two carrycots that are side-by-side which is great for siblings of varying age.

Multiple configurations
The seating arrangement of your twin pushchair could affect its functionality. Consider a variety of seating options so that you can switch up the direction of your children's seats based on their mood or the circumstances and continue to use them as they develop. The Bugaboo Donkey 5 Twin, for instance, is extremely versatile, with reversible seat and bassinet configurations that allow siblings to be facing each other either with you or the exciting route ahead. The frame expands to accommodate an extra seat. It can be used in Mono or Double mode. A variety of accessories are available for both configurations.

Stores
You'll be carrying lots of things for twins, so look for a spacious undercarriage basket and plenty of pockets or compartments to store your essentials. Make sure that the storage areas are easy to access with the seats in different positions as well. The UPPAbaby Vista 2 is able to carry twins, a baby and a toddler.
